ABSTRACT

In the present article, we construct the exact traveling wave solutions of nonlinear PDEs in mathematical physics via the variant Boussinesq equations and the coupled KdV equations by using the extended mapping method and auxiliary equation method. This method is more powerful and will be used in further works to establish more entirely new solutions for other kinds of nonlinear partial differential equations arising in mathematical physics.
